The difference between an AngiOSperm and a Gymnosperm is that AngiOSperms are flowering plants while Gymnosperms are not. A. include plants that use flowers to reproduce. An angiOSperm also forms seeds inside a protective chamber called an ovary and a gymnosperm bears naked seeds (no ovary).
